What to do when Nintendo Switch game cards are no longer read Immediate measures
- Completely turn off your Nintendo Switch, wait a moment, and restart it before reinserting the game card.
- Test whether only a specific game card is not recognized or if multiple cartridges are affected.
- Carefully check the game card for visible dirt, scratches, or damaged contacts.
- Do not blow into the game card slot, as moisture can get into the game card slot and promote corrosion.
- Avoid using force when inserting or removing the game card to prevent further bending of the delicate pins in the card reader.
Why Nintendo Switch game cards not being read needs professional help
The Nintendo Switch game card reader consists of very fine contact pins, a delicate connector, and internal flex cables connected to the mainboard. If dirt, liquid, bent pins, or a defective card reader are involved, a DIY repair can quickly cause more damage than the original problem. Particularly risky are unsuitable cleaning agents, metal tools, or opening the console without experience, as this can damage the display, battery, fan, motherboard, or ribbon cables.
- The Nintendo Switch shows "The game card could not be read" or a similar error message.
- Game cards are only sometimes recognized and suddenly stop working during gameplay.
- The game card slot feels loose or the card no longer clicks in cleanly.
- Multiple games no longer work, even though the game cards are read on another console.
